Percy & Reed No Oil Oil

Having seen this featured in Stella (the Telegraph supplement magazine) and Cosmopolitan, I simply had to give it a go. After years of bleach and heat abuse, my blonde locks are in desperate need of some TLC, and this looked pretty promising. At £14 for 60ml, it seemed like a worthwhile investment, and the only thing left to do was to see if it actually works...

The Claims- 'For silky hair which is as smooth as a Singapore Sling at sunset, we’ve used our special frizz-fighting pomegranate seed oil. Not only that, it will nourish and repair your hair too, while pro vitamin B5 gives you strength and heat protection.'


The Reality- Given this miraculous heatwave we're having, there has never been a better time to test an anti-frizz serum, and No Oil Oil doesn't disappoint. Normally I'm a bit hesitant to use serum on dry hair, as it tends to look greasy, but in the interest of science I decided to take one for the team. Surprisingly, it spread through my hair quite easily without any notable build up. Even better, my hands weren't even remotely greasy or sticky afterwards. Must be that No Oil formula of theirs...

On wet hair, it's equally as impressive, and results in a beautifully smooth blow dry. Not only that, but it's soft (and fellow bleach blondes out there will know how impressive that is!). Does it smell like pomegranate? In all honesty, I can't remember having ever sniffed one, but it definitely smells good!

The final test came fours later when I returned home from a particularly sweaty Rihanna concert, with, get this- SMOOTH HAIR!

All in all, I'd definitely recommend this product, and at just £14 you ought to try it too!
